The 1986 FIFA World Cup, hosted by Mexico, was a tournament filled with unforgettable moments. Diego Maradona's infamous "Hand of God" goal and his breathtaking solo effort against England are etched in football lore forever. The atmosphere in the stadiums was electric, the fans passionate, and the entire nation united behind their team. The i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986 became a symbol of this unity and passion. The design, typically featuring the iconic green, white, and red of the Mexican flag, captured the spirit of the tournament and the country. Beyond the sporting achievements, the 1986 World Cup had a profound cultural impact. Mexico's ability to host the tournament on short notice, after Colombia withdrew, showcased the country's resilience and organizational capabilities. The tournament brought people together, transcending social and economic divides. Identifying an Authentic i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986
So, you're on the hunt for an authentic i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986? Here’s what to look for:
- Manufacturer's Markings: The original jerseys were typically manufactured by Adidas. Look for the Adidas logo and any accompanying text. The quality of the stitching and the clarity of the logo are key indicators. Counterfeit jerseys often have poorly defined logos or incorrect font usage. Examining the manufacturer's markings closely can quickly reveal whether a jersey is genuine or a reproduction. Always compare the markings with known authentic examples to ensure accuracy.
 - Fabric Quality: The fabric used in the original jerseys was a specific type of polyester. It should feel durable and have a certain weight to it. Modern reproductions often use cheaper, lighter materials that lack the same feel. The texture of the fabric should be consistent throughout the jersey, and there should be no signs of loose threads or uneven weaving. Authentic jerseys were made to withstand the rigors of professional play, so the fabric quality reflects this durability. Feel the i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986.
 - Tags and Labels: Check the tags for accurate sizing information, care instructions, and country of origin. The information should be printed clearly and accurately. Authentic jerseys usually have multiple tags, including a main tag at the collar and smaller tags indicating fabric composition and care instructions. Examine the stitching of the tags themselves; original jerseys will have clean, precise stitching, while counterfeit jerseys often have sloppy or uneven stitching. The presence of correct tags is a strong indicator of authenticity.
 - Details in the Design: Pay close attention to the details of the design, such as the placement of the Mexican Football Federation (FMF) crest and the Adidas stripes. The colors should be vibrant and accurate. Any discrepancies or inaccuracies could indicate a fake. The official FMF crest should be meticulously embroidered with precise detailing. The Adidas stripes should be evenly spaced and perfectly aligned along the sleeves. Any deviations from these standards are red flags. Genuine i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986 were manufactured with strict attention to detail, and these details are crucial for authentication.

Caring for Your Vintage Jersey
So, you've managed to snag an authentic i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986 – congrats! Now, let's talk about keeping it in prime condition. These jerseys are delicate pieces of history, and proper care is crucial to preserving their value and ensuring they last for years to come.
- Washing: Avoid machine washing if possible. Hand wash the jersey in cold water with a mild detergent. Never use bleach or harsh chemicals, as these can damage the fabric and fade the colors. Gently agitate the jersey in the water and rinse thoroughly. Avoid wringing or twisting the jersey, as this can stretch the fabric and damage the stitching. Instead, gently press out excess water with a towel. Proper washing techniques are essential for maintaining the integrity of the i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986.
 - Drying: Never put the jersey in the dryer! Always air dry it, preferably indoors and away from direct sunlight. Direct sunlight can cause the colors to fade over time. Lay the jersey flat on a clean, dry surface or hang it on a padded hanger to prevent stretching. Ensure that the jersey is completely dry before storing it to prevent mildew or mold growth. Patience is key when drying a vintage jersey; allow ample time for it to air dry completely.
 - Storage: Store the jersey in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. Consider using a garment bag to protect it from dust and pests. Avoid storing the jersey in a plastic bag, as this can trap moisture and lead to deterioration. Acid-free tissue paper can be used to pad the jersey and prevent creases. Proper storage is crucial for preserving the condition and value of your iplayera Mexico Mundial 1986. Regularly check on the jersey to ensure that it remains in good condition.
